Summary:

This course introduces users to the Visual InterDev interface and application creation. At the end of this course, users will create a new Web project and add HTML pages.

Objectives:

  • Use the Visual InterDev views and controls
  • Explain how Visual InterDev interacts with databases
  • Describe Visual InterDev's client and server directory structures
  • Create a simple Web application using Visual InterDev


Topics:

  • Introduction to Visual InterDev
  • Visual InterDev Views and Controls
  • Other Visual InterDev Components
  • Using Visual InterDev with Databases
  • Creating an Application
  • Viewing InterDev Results
